North Carolina Wedding Venue with Questionable Name Refuses to Refund Money After Groom Dies, ‘In the Long Run, This is Gonna Cost Them Wayyyyyyy More Than 18K’ 

That was certainly a decision, but not a good one

Maggie HoffmanBy Maggie HoffmanSeptember 28, 20253 Mins Read
North Carolina Wedding Venue with Questionable Name Refuses to Refund Money After Groom Dies
Image Source: michi_a22 TikTok via The Nerd Stash

The wedding venue you choose for your special day is one of the most important decisions you’ll make in the wedding planning process. Unfortunately, no matter where you choose to hold your wedding, it’s probably going to cost you. For one bride, she discovered that she would have to put an $18,000 deposit down at a North Carolina venue. However, something terrible happened that unexpectedly called off the wedding. Now, the venue is refusing to refund her the money, and the circumstances are disgusting.

Michi (@michi_a22) posted a TikTok concerning a wedding venue in North Carolina that’s now under fire for some adverse choices it made. In the video, she explains that a Durham, North Carolina wedding venue is “greedy, heartless, and lacks morale.” The venue in question? “The Cotton Room.” First, let’s focus on the name, just like Michi does in her video. The name allegedly comes from the fact that the venue is a 1900s textile factory that was transformed into a venue. But are we just going to breeze over the fact that it’s also kinda…racist? Maybe a better name choice could have been made here? This is considering the fact that North Carolina is known for having a large number of plantations with a huge cotton crop economy. African-American people were forced to work on these plantations in the most brutal conditions. So, the name isn’t a great choice. 

But here’s where things get even more messed up: The Cotton Room is under fire because of what they recently did to a grieving bride. A bride’s spouse tragically passed away a few months before their wedding date. They have already put down a $18,000 deposit on The Cotton Room as their venue. Now, they’re refusing to return the deposit to the bride even though she’s going through one of the most devastating experiences of her life. Furthermore, she won’t even be able to marry her fiancé – this is just a big slap in the face. 

The groom, Chris Perry, passed away back in May, even though his wedding day was set for October 11. Despite the devastating circumstances, The Cotton Room insisted that the money can’t be returned. They refuse to breach their contract even though the family says the venue did literally nothing toward their wedding except hold their spot for them. Michi said she doesn’t understand why they would want to harm their business like this. Refunding this couple would have secured them as a good business in most people’s eyes. Now, they just look plain evil.
